[0001] This utility model relates to vehicles, specifically providing a storage box for a vehicle and the vehicle itself. Background Technology
[0002] Most existing electric vehicles adopt a layout where the drive unit is located at the bottom of the vehicle, thus reserving space at the front for a front trunk to meet users' storage needs. This front trunk typically includes a body and a matching lid, which can be opened or closed relative to the body to access items. During use, to enhance the sealing performance when the lid is closed and prevent external dust, moisture, or rainwater from seeping into the trunk and affecting the dryness and cleanliness of stored items, existing technologies often include a sealing strip along the edge of the body. This strip engages with the lid when closed, forming an effective sealing structure. (See details...) Figure 1 .
[0003] However, while placing the sealing strip at the edge of the suitcase achieves basic sealing, it introduces new technical problems. First, the sealing strip raises the edge of the suitcase, making it difficult for users to smoothly place or retrieve luggage, especially larger suitcases. Second, because the sealing strip is exposed at the top edge of the suitcase, users are prone to contact with it during luggage handling, potentially causing localized scratches or wear, affecting its sealing performance, and also allowing dust accumulated on the sealing strip to transfer to the luggage surface, reducing the overall user experience. Third, some users may need to sit on the edge of the front trunk; a sealing strip at the edge of the suitcase can obstruct this seating, and dirt on the sealing strip can easily stain clothing. Furthermore, from an aesthetic perspective, this type of sealing structure often affects the overall visual appeal of the front trunk.
[0004] Therefore, there is an urgent need in the field for a vehicle storage box and a vehicle to solve the above problems. Utility Model Content
[0005] The present invention aims to solve the above-mentioned technical problems, namely, to solve the problems that the existing trunk has high edges, making it inconvenient to take out and put in luggage and causing wear on the sealing strip, and the sealing strip also prevents users from sitting on the edge of the front trunk, as well as the poor appearance of the front trunk.

[0034] Reference Figure 1In existing technology, the sealing strip 3 of the front trunk of a vehicle typically has a frame 4 inside, and the sealing strip 3 is secured to the edge of the trunk body 1 by the frame 4. Although this arrangement secures the sealing strip 3, the presence of the frame 4 results in a larger volume and heavier sealing strip 3, thus increasing the overall vehicle weight and material costs. Furthermore, placing the sealing strip 3 at the edge of the trunk body 1 increases the structural height at that point, making it difficult for users to smoothly place or retrieve items, especially when carrying large suitcases. Users are prone to contact with the sealing strip 3 during use, causing wear and tear and affecting its sealing performance; moreover, dust easily adheres to the surface of the sealing strip, which may contaminate the luggage items it comes into contact with, reducing the user experience and affecting the overall aesthetic appearance of the front trunk.
[0035] To address the problems of existing trunk lids having high edges, causing inconvenience in loading and unloading luggage and wear on the sealing strip 3, as well as the sealing strip preventing users from sitting on the edge of the front trunk and resulting in an unattractive appearance of the front trunk, this embodiment discloses a vehicle including a front trunk. (Refer to...) Figure 2 The front trunk includes a trunk body 1, a trunk lid 2, and a sealing strip 3.
[0036] Regarding the box 1, it should be noted that although the box 1 in this embodiment is the front trunk of the vehicle, this arrangement is not a limitation of the present invention. Without departing from the principle of the present invention, those skilled in the art can set the box 1 in other parts of the vehicle according to specific application needs. For example, the box 1 is the rear trunk of the vehicle, or other storage box structures. This does not depart from the basic principle of the present invention and therefore will fall within the protection scope of the present invention.
[0037] The main structure of the box body 1 is the same as that of the front trunk box body 1 in the prior art, and its specific structure will not be described in detail here. A sealing part 11 and a drainage groove 12 are provided at the edge of the box body 1, and the sealing part 11 and drainage groove 12 are provided along the edge of the box body 1, at least on the portion of the edge of the box body 1 facing outwards from the vehicle body. The sealing part 11 is shaped as a horizontal surface at the edge of the box body 1. The drainage groove 12 is located inside the sealing part 11. Figure 2 A drainage groove 12 is located on the left side of the sealing part 11. The left side of the drainage groove 12 is an internal cavity of the housing 1, which is not shown in the figure. The drainage groove 12 is a downwardly recessed groove used to collect liquid. Furthermore, the bottom surface of the drainage groove 12 can be set as a slope to allow the liquid in the drainage groove 12 to flow along the slope, facilitating liquid drainage. The bottom of the drainage groove 12 is lower than the sealing part 11, and the top of the side wall of the drainage groove 12 away from the sealing part 11 is higher than the sealing part 11. Figure 2The left side wall of the drainage trough 12. This arrangement forms an effective liquid barrier structure, preventing external liquid from crossing the seal 11 and entering the interior of the housing 1. A drainage hole 13 is provided at the bottom of the drainage trough 12, connecting the drainage trough 12 to the outside of the housing 1. The drainage hole 13 allows liquid accumulated in the drainage trough 12 to be discharged promptly, further enhancing drainage and seepage prevention performance. Furthermore, multiple drainage holes 13 can be provided at the bottom of the drainage trough 12; the specific number of drainage holes 13 can be determined according to the length and width of the drainage trough 12.

[0039] The structure of the trunk lid 2 is the same as that of the front trunk lid 2 in the prior art, and its specific structure will not be described in detail here. A mounting bracket 21 is provided on the lower edge surface of the trunk lid 2. The mounting bracket 21 is in the shape of an inverted "V". Those skilled in the art will understand that this utility model does not impose any limitations on the shape of the mounting bracket 21. The mounting bracket 21 can obviously be set to other shapes, and these changes obviously do not deviate from the basic principles of this utility model and fall within the protection scope of this utility model. When the trunk lid 2 closes the trunk body 1, a preset gap is provided between the mounting bracket 21 and the sealing part 11, and the sealing strip 3 is set at this preset gap. The mounting bracket 21 is provided with a through hole 22 for connecting the sealing strip 3. The sealing strip 3 includes a connecting part 31, and the connecting part 31 is provided with a buckle. The buckle can extend into the through hole 22 to connect the sealing strip 3 to the trunk lid 2. Since the sealing strip 3 is set on the trunk lid 2, when the trunk lid 2 is opened, the sealing strip 3 will move accordingly. This design avoids the structural protrusion problem caused by the sealing strip 3 being located at the edge of the compartment 1 in traditional structures, effectively reducing the edge height of the compartment 1 and improving user convenience when loading and unloading luggage. This structure reduces the risk of scratches on the sealing strip 3 when handling luggage, and prevents dust on the sealing strip 3 from contaminating luggage, further improving the cleanliness and aesthetics of the front trunk. This design also prevents the sealing strip 3 from obstructing the user's seating position on the edge of the compartment, enhancing the user experience of the front trunk.

[0041] The connecting part 31 is located outside the sealing strip 3; in other words, there is no skeleton 4 inside the sealing strip 3. This arrangement simplifies the internal structure of the sealing strip 3, making the overall weight of the sealing strip 3 lighter and the volume smaller, which helps to reduce the amount of material used and manufacturing costs. At the same time, it plays a positive role in the lightweight design of the whole vehicle and further improves the energy efficiency performance of the vehicle.
[0042] The sealing strip 3 has a cavity inside. When the sealing strip 3 comes into contact with the sealing part 11, it is squeezed by the sealing part 11, causing the sealing strip 3 to deform. Figure 2 The shape of the deformed sealing strip 3 is not shown. A sealing surface is formed between the deformed sealing strip 3 and the sealing part 11. The sealing strip 3 is provided along the edge of the lid 2, and the sealing strip 3 is correspondingly provided with the sealing part 11. When the lid 2 closes the box body 1, the sealing surface between the sealing strip 3 and the sealing part 11 can seal the gap between the box body 1 and the lid 2.
[0043] Reference Figure 1 and Figure 2 Compared to existing technologies, the sealing surface in this embodiment is located below the sealing strip 3. This allows external liquids such as rainwater and road puddles outside the front trunk to easily seep into the interior of the trunk 1 through the sealing surface. To prevent liquid from entering the interior of the trunk 1, a drainage groove 12 is provided on the inner side of the sealing surface to collect any liquid that may seep in. Since the top of the side wall of the drainage groove 12, which is away from the sealing surface, is higher than the sealing surface, this side wall can also effectively prevent liquid from further flowing into the interior of the trunk 1. The liquid collected in the drainage groove 12 can be discharged to the outside of the trunk 1 through the drainage hole 13 located at its bottom, thereby achieving effective drainage and seepage prevention functions.
